RFID 태그의 이력 추적을 위한 시간 간격 색인 : SLR-트리

A Time Interval Index for Tracking Trajectories of RFID Tags : SLR-Tree

  • 류우석 (부산대학교 컴퓨터공학과) ;
  • 안성우 (부산대학교 컴퓨터공학과) ;
  • 홍봉희 (부산대학교 컴퓨터공학과) ;
  • 반재훈 (경남정보대학 인터넷응용계열) ;
  • 이세호 (삼성전자 정보통신총괄)
  • 발행 : 2007.02.15

초록

RFID 시스템에서의 태그의 궤적은 태그가 리더의 인식영역에 들어왔을 때와 벗어날 때의 시공간 위치를 선분으로 연결하여 표현한다. 그러나 태그가 리더의 인식영역을 벗어난 후 다음 리더의 인식영역에 들어올 때까지는 태그의 위치를 파악할 수 없으므로 태그의 궤적은 연결되어 있지 않고 단절된 간격의 집합으로 표현된다. 그러므로 태그의 이력을 검색하기 위해서는 전체 색인을 검색해야 하는 문제가 발생한다. 이 논문에서는 높은 궤적 검색 비용문제를 해결하기 위해 전자태그의 간격을 연결하기 위한 기법을 제시하고 이 기법을 적용한 색인인 SLR-tree를 제안한다. 또한, 연결 정보의 추가로 인한 노드의 공간 활용도의 저하를 최소화하기 위하여 두 간격간의 연결정보를 공유하기 위한 기법을 제안하고 노드의 분할 시 공유정보를 유지하기 위한 분할 정책을 제안한다. 마지막으로 제안된 색인에 대한 성능을 비교평가 함으로써 이력검색 성능의 우수성을 입증한다.

The trajectory of a tag in RFID system is represented as a interval that connects two spatiotemporal locations captured when the tag enters and leaves the vicinity of a reader. Whole trajectories of a tag are represented as a set of unconnected interval because the location of the tag which left the vicinity of a reader is unknown until it enters the vicinity of another reader. The problems are that trajectories of a tag are not connected. It takes a long time to find trajectories of a tag because it leads to searching the whole index. To solve this problem, we propose a technique that links two intervals of the tag and an index scheme called SLR-tree. We also propose a sharing technique of link information between two intervals which enhances space utilization of nodes, and propose a split policy that preserves shared-link information. And finally, we evaluate the performance of the proposed index and prove that the index processes history queries efficiently.

키워드

참고문헌

  1. S. E. Sarma, S. A. Weis, and D. W. Engels, 'RFID Systems and Security and Privacy Implications,' Springer-Verlag, pp.454-469, 2002
  2. N. Beckmann and H. P. Kriegel, 'The R*-tree: An Efficient and Robust Access Method for Points and Rectangles,' Proc. ACM SIGMOD, pp.332-331, 1990
  3. A. Guttman, 'R-Trees: A dynamic index structure for spatial searching,' In Proc. of the 1984 ACM SIGMOD Intl. Conf. on Management of Data, pp.47-57, June 1984
  4. Y. Theodoridis, M. Vassilakopoulos, and T. Sellis, 'Spatio-temporal indexing for large multimedia applications,' In Proc. of the 3rd IEEE Conf. on Multimedia Computing and Systems, pp.441-448, June 1996
  5. D. Pfoser, C. S. Jensen, and Y. Theodoridis, 'Novel Approaches to the Indexing of Moving Objects,' In Proc. of the 26th VLDB Conf, pp.395-406, 2000
  6. M. A. Nascimento and J.R.O. Silva, 'Towards historical R-Trees,' In Proc. of the 1998 ACM Symposium on applied Computing, pp.235-240, February 1998
  7. M. A. Nascimento, J. T. O. Silca, and Y. Theodoridis, 'Evaluation of access structures for discretel moving points,' Proc. Of Int'l Workshop on Spatio-Temporal Database Management, pp.171-188, 1999
  8. C. Kolovson and M. Stonebraker, 'Segment Indexes: Dynamic Indexing Techniques for Multi-Dimensional Interval Data,' Proc. ACM SIGMOD, pp.138-147, 1991
  9. J. L. Bently, 'Algorithms for Klee's Rectangle Problems,' Computer Science Department, Carnegie-Mellon University, Pittsburgh, 1977
  10. B. CheaHoon. BongHee Hong, 'Time Parameterized Interval R-tree for Tracing Tags in RFID Systems,' 16th International Conference, DEXA 2005 (pp. 503-513)
  11. K. Romer, T. Schoch, 'Infrastructure Concepts for Tag-Based Ubiquitous Computing Applications,' Workshop on Concepts and Models for Ubiquitous Computing, Ubicomp 2002, Goteborg, Sweden, September 2002
  12. Mark Harrison, 'EPCTM Information Service-Data Model and Queries,' 2003